- Provides nursing services to students with special medical needs subject to IEP and 504 Plans.
- Conducts school health services, including physical assessments, tests for visual acuity, scoliosis screening, personal health counseling, and appropriate emergency health services.
- Observes students to detect health needs and refers students in need of medical care.
- Gathers and provides information regarding students' medical matters.
- Maintains up-to-date cumulative health records on all students and participates in coordination of services.
- Monitors compliance of school health program with federal, state and local laws, regulations and policies.
- Participates as an advisor, consultant, and expert resource person for school staff in developing and implementing the needs of individual students.
- Provides recommendations to administration for exclusion and readmission of students in connection with infectious and contagious diseases.
- Actively participates in committee meetings regarding school health services, curriculum and environmental safety.
- Collaborates with other child-support and community agencies.
- Participates in and contributes to meetings in determining eligibility for special education services and in developing individual educational programs for those students who qualify.
- Provides consultation in health related policies, goals and objectives of the school district.
- Manages program allotment efficiently and maintains security of school health supplies.
- Teaches First Aid, CPR, AED and/or other health related classes to staff and students.
